I just want a report that is products sold by net price in company currency - AKA a PRODUCTS SOLD REPORT.
E.g. a report to say we’ve sold product A in 53 deals. The net value of that over the year is 120,000 CAD
Use cases: Resource planning; are we spending the right amount of resources on products against their revenue contribution?
Should we raise/ lower price on a given product because of avg./ median price we’re selling it at?
Currently, I can generate a report based on deals won, by line item (aka product) and sum the net price, but as we do deals in multiple countries, the result is a mix or currencies.
Easy fix: Add a NET PRICE IN COMPANY CURRENCY property to line items.
More complete fix; allow custom properties in the line items objects.
I have a similar problem. I run a music school, and want to use HubSpot to calculate monthly teacher payments. In my case, teachers are paid based off of invoices PAID, not invoices sent.
What would be nice is if when a customer paid an invoice with multiple line items, it recorded that payment in connection with those line items. Surprisingly, it currently does not do this. You can associate Customers and Deals with an Invoice, which is then transferred to the Payment when a customer pays, but HubSpot does not calculate which portion of a payment corresponds to each line item. I understand that calculating Net Revanue per line item would be a little more complicated because of Fees, Discounts, and Taxes that are calculated at the invoice level (not calculated at the line item level). But at the very least, I would appreciate the abilty to run a report on Gross Revanue per Line Item (before fees, discounts, taxes, & refunds)…
